#585969 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#585969 is composed of 34.5% red, 34.9%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.2% cyan, 15.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 236.5 degrees, a saturation of 8.8% and a lightness of 37.8%. #585969 color hex could be obtained by blending #b0b2d2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

#585969 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#585969 has RGB values of R:88, G:89,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0.16, M:0.15, Y:0,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 5790057.

Shades and Tints of #585969
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080809 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#585969
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5f6062 is the less saturated color, while #0611bb is the most saturated one.
